I believe I can provide some extra insight on this. It is correct that WebScraping requires a DNS resolver. The DNS Resolver is basically used to cache DNS responses. The Forward Zone within that resolver is then used to forward DNS requests that aren't already found in the cache. So you should be able to create a resolver with a Forward Zone that has a name that is just "." like you see in nathe's comment with his configuration. Then just add your DNS server IPs to the Resolver as well. This should effectively cause the Forward Zone to forward all DNS requests to your DNS servers so long as there is no response already cached by the Resolver.
